TMI Products Announces Schedule for the 2026 TRIM Road Tour
The competition will kick off at the 76th Annual Grand National Roadster Show, where the first of five winners will be selected…
Designer and manufacturer of custom automotive interiors, TMI Products, has unveiled the 2026 TRIM Road Tour schedule, featuring five national stops leading into the 2026 TMI Products TRIM Awards at the SEMA Show in Las Vegas, Nevada.
Now entering its fifth year, this multi-stop competition highlights the best TMI‑equipped custom interiors from across the country, company officials said in a press release. At each stop, a panel of independent judges will select the vehicle that best represents what is possible with a TMI interior. From these five events, one finalist from each stop will advance, ultimately culminating in the selection of the 2026 TRIM Road Tour Champion, who will be invited to compete in the TRIM Awards in Las Vegas.
Entry Form for the TMI Road Tour
TMI is calling on vehicles nationwide to enter the 2026 TRIM Road Tour, noted the release. The tour begins at the 76th Annual Grand National Roadster Show (GNRS) at the Fairplex in Pomona, California, taking place Jan. 30–Feb. 1, 2026.
Participants may submit their vehicles online, where entries will be added to the judging roster. The first 2026 TRIM Road Tour winner will be announced on the GNRS stage the afternoon of Sunday, Feb. 1, 2026.
The Next Four Stops
Four additional stops are planned for the 2026 TRIM Awards season, which will include Hot Rods & Heroes Huntington Beach, California (March 29); the C10 Nationals in Fort Worth, Texas (May 8-9); the TMI Cars & Clearance event, held at the TMI Products headquarters in Corona, California (Aug. 15); with the final stop happening at the Triple Crown of Rodding event in Nashville, Tennessee (Sept. 11-12). Comprehensive details surrounding each of the additional events will be announced before each stop, the company said.
Selecting the 2026 TRIM Road Tour Champion
Directly following the selection of the TRIM Road Tour winner at the Triple Crown event, the judges will gather to pick the 2026 TRIM Road Tour champion from the group of five winners. This individual will earn a trip to Las Vegas to attend the SEMA Show (Nov. 3-6, 2026) with a Top 20 finalist spot at the TMI Products’ Trim Awards event, a feature parking spot at the SEMA Show and a five-night hotel stay during the event.
